The near-infrared output of the nucleus of NGC 1068 increased by a factor of two over the 18 years between 1976 and 1994 and has recently started to decline. It is not clear whether this event has been the response of an extended dusty region to a single outburst in the central engine or is the result of a continuous change in its XUV output. The integrated energy of the event amounts to well over 1052 erg and thus cannot be due to a single supernova.
